Dark Reading: Bots Hard To Kill -- Even When Botnets Get Decapitated
Despite the wave of major takedowns this past year, botnets are still thriving with a seemingly endless supply of bots available to feed the beast
Oct 15, 2010
By Kelly Jackson Higgins
When the Waledac botnet was dismantled by a security community-wide effort earlier this year, spam traffic immediately and discernibly dropped in a big way. But the researchers who worked in the trenches to shut down the botnet acknowledge that these takedowns are more of a temporary, short-term solution to a much bigger problem: the difficulty of completely eradicating these networks for cybercrime with such a bounty of available bots and bot candidates.
